
Enfrijoladas
Mexican tortillas dipped in creamy black bean sauce

Prepare the bean sauceHeat 2 tablespoons of o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and sauté for 3-4 minutes until translucent. Add the minced garlic and cook for another 30 seconds until fragrant. Add the black beans, chipotle pepper (if using), cumin, and vegetable broth. Bring to a simmer and cook for 5 minutes.
-
Blend the sauceTransfer the bean mixture to a blender and blend until smooth. If the sauce is too thick, add more broth or water to reach a consistency similar to heavy cream. Return the sauce to the pan and keep warm on low heat, stirring occasionally.
-
Prepare the tortillasIn a separate skillet, heat about 1/4 inch of vegetable oil over medium-high heat. Briefly fry each tortilla for about 10 seconds per side until soft but not crispy. Drain on paper towels to remove excess oil.
-
Dip and fold the tortillasDip each tortilla into the warm bean sauce, making sure it's completely coated. Fold the tortilla in half or roll it up and place on a serving plate. Repeat with all tortillas, arranging them on plates.
-
Finish and garnishPour additional bean sauce over the enfrijoladas. Sprinkle with crumbled queso fresco, drizzle with Mexican crema, and top with diced onions and chopped cilantro. Serve immediately while still warm.

Enfrijoladas are Also Known As
Enfrijoladas Mexicanas, Black Bean Enchiladas or Tortillas with Bean Sauce
